‘Sons Of Anarchy’ Recoil: Accepting The Truths Of “John 8:32” Sets Viewers Free [SPOILERS]


All truths were revealed in the latest Sons of Anarchy episode, entitled “John 8:32.” Tara’s cat is out of the proverbial bag, with Jax and the Sons of Anarchy MC all aware of her devilish deals.

The title of episode nine of Sons of Anarchy’s sixth season is a common phrase that has grown from its biblical origins: “Then you will know the truth, and the truth will set you free.” When you get right down to it, that’s what the latest Sons installment was all about. With the big reveal, Tara is free from the burden of her secret maneuvers and Gemma is free from Jax’s wrath.

The episode began with a continuous cross-cut from Jax and Tara to Gemma and Nero. The former Sons of Anarchy queen is catching her papi up on what went down when he was in holding. Incredulous, Nero tries to be the calming outside influence, first talking to Jax. That doesn’t go to well, with the Sons of Anarchy pres essentially warning the Byz-Lats O.G. to mind his own business. Nero then makes the mistake of going to Tara; he minds his manners, but Tara, now so duplicitous in nature, reveals an entirely different tale to Jax, leading to a fantastic confrontation at Diosa. As Jax and Nero rip each other to pieces in the kitchen, Gemma shows up and implores Happy to break it up.

After some harsh opening words, the conversation switches to revelation: Gemma tells Jax and the other Sons about how Nero had copped to the gun charges in order to spare the Sons of Anarchy the wrath of D.A. Patterson. That shuts Jax up a bit, as does the disclosure of Gemma being forced to consummate in her conjugal visit with Clay. Mama Teller lays it all out: the false pregnancy, the divorce and custody plans, capped off with Margaret Miller’s tacit admission. But Gemma doesn’t tell the head of the Sons of Anarchy table to take her word for it; she encourages Jax to find someone who knows. That someone ends up being Tara’s lawyer, Ally Lowen, who spills the truth in a tense scene inside Unser’s trailer. Lowen calls Tara to let her know Jax is aware of everything and the latest Sons of Anarchy episode closes with her holding one of their sons and a gun in her lap.

Sons of Anarchy creator Kurt Sutter sat down with Entertainment Weekly to discuss the episode. On the betrayal between Sons of Anarchy president Jackson Teller and Doctor Tara, he pondered the emotional fallout:

“Obviously the betrayal is a deep one, but it’s also a different kind of betrayal for Jax. It’s not like the betrayal of an enemy or a betrayal of a brother. How does he respond to the betrayal of the woman he loves and the mother of his child?”
